Web Design Brief
We need a UI design for a touch screen device to be used by costumers in a store and show information about specific products. We're looking for a general concept to serve as a starting point and we're not expecting a fully coded design.
We envision a UI where it first shows a range of products; once touched, it should show information about the product which includes text, touchable photos, videos and document files. We're interested in the starting page and the product details page.
We are the suppliers of the device and not the owners of stores that will use them. The purpose of this design is for in-person demonstrations to potential clients or in ads so the design should be agnostic about the end product(s). You may freely pick random placeholder or fictional products and assets to showcase the design concept as long as they can be changed without compromising the design. You can use our logo (annexed) in the design as a placeholder but it's not necessary.
We're using web technologies to develop the UI so the same principles should apply, except some exceptions below:
- There's no need for a responsive design since the resolution is set at 1920x1080 on a 22'' monitor in landscape orientation.
- All interactions will be done using the touchscreen, so any interactive component needs to be large enough for navigation to be comfortable.
- The design should be visually engaging and eye-catching, more so than a regular website.
